Must be a contest going with all that crowded CW at the beginning. Here's one thing you could add (if you were more into CW, that is): a SCAF filter you can switch in and out of the audio. With one of those, you could pretty-much separate that cloud of signals. I like the idea of receiving CW with an SSB bandwidth (or wider) and then using a SCAF to narrow down to a single signal rather than using a narrow IF filter with its "tunnel vision." --K7TFC
